Welcome to the ReminderPing crew! This job texts patients at Maplebrook Clinic about upcoming appointments, running every morning at 6. As release manager, you'll cut the weekly build and push it to the scheduler box. Config lives in the job's .env file — most values are boring. Before your first release, add the SMS provider secret on the next line.

sealed setting: ARCHIVE_KEY3=8d0

Handing off the Perchlight kiosk watchdog before I rotate onto the Brindlewick project. The watchdog restarts the kiosk app if the heartbeat goes quiet for 90 seconds — fine, except it also fires during OTA updates, so we suppress it via a flag file. Don't remove that hack until the updater sets its own maintenance mode. Logs rotate daily on-device. Full notes and the known-quirks list are on the internal wiki page here.

wiki page, tahaf-tajog: https://jira.ordindyn.corp/pipeline

## Soft deletes in `orders`

Welcome aboard! Heads up: we never hard-delete rows in the Plumwick orders table. Deletes just set `deleted_at`, and a nightly sweeper archives anything older than the retention window. Queries must filter on the flag or you'll resurrect ghost orders in reports (ask anyone about the Q3 incident). The sweeper reads its settings from the block below.

config for kafof-bawef:
holath:
  log_level: debug
  metrics_host: metrics.holath.qorvelsys.internal
  pin: 2191
  pool_size: 32